BAL 23225 C-Jack: The Most Stable Design

The BAL C-Jack features a unique telescopic design that distinguishes it from traditional scissor-style jacks. Unlike the standard “X” frame that can sway slightly under load, the C-Jack offers superior lateral stability by bracing the frame more effectively as it extends. This design is highly favored by those who struggle with the “bouncy” feeling common in long or high-profile tiny homes.

The added stability comes from the way the arms lock into position, creating a rigid connection between the trailer frame and the ground. This eliminates much of the micro-vibration that typical scissor jacks allow. It is a more robust piece of engineering that feels significantly more secure once everything is tightened down.

If you are particularly sensitive to motion or have a tiny home with a tall loft or heavy interior cabinetry, the BAL C-Jack is the superior choice. It requires a bit more clearance for installation and is slightly bulkier, but the trade-off is an noticeably more solid living experience. Choosing this design is a commitment to maximum stability.

Leveling vs. Stabilizing: A Critical Guide

A common mistake is assuming that jacks are designed to lift and level the entire weight of a tiny home. In reality, jacks are meant to stabilize the structure, not support the full vertical load, which should remain on the trailer’s tires and axles. Using jacks to lift the frame can lead to frame damage, door misalignment, and hydraulic or mechanical failure.

Leveling must be accomplished using blocks, ramps, or leveling boards under the tires before the jacks are deployed. Once the home is level and the tires are bearing the weight, the jacks should be lowered just until they make firm contact with the ground. “Firm contact” means enough pressure to stop movement, not enough to lift the frame off its suspension.

Understanding this distinction is the difference between a home that settles well and one that develops structural cracks. Over-extending a jack to lift the home creates stress concentration points on the trailer frame, which were not designed for that type of localized support. Always level first, then stabilize second.

How Many Jacks Do You Need for Your Tiny Home?

The number of jacks required depends entirely on the length and weight distribution of your tiny home. A standard 20-foot tiny home typically requires four jacks—one at each corner—to provide sufficient stability. However, as the length of the trailer increases, so does the risk of the middle section “bouncing” or sagging.

For any tiny home longer than 24 feet, adding a set of mid-ship jacks is strongly recommended to prevent floor flex. Long, unsupported spans are the primary cause of creaky floors and unstable appliances. By adding central support, you distribute the weight more evenly and drastically reduce the vibration felt inside.

Always consult your trailer manufacturer’s specifications regarding weight distribution points. Placing jacks in areas not designed for load bearing—like the very end of a cantilever—can bend the frame rails. Stick to the frame’s designated structural members for the best results.

Proper Jack Placement and Installation Tips

Placement is just as important as the quality of the jack itself. Jacks should be mounted to the main structural frame rails of the trailer, never to the thin cross-members or the flooring structure. If the mounting surface is uneven or too thin, reinforce it with steel plating or heavy-duty angle iron before bolting the jacks in place.

Use high-strength, grade 5 or grade 8 hardware when bolting jacks to the frame. The constant movement and vibration of a tiny home will loosen standard hardware over time, so ensure all bolts are properly tensioned and secured with locking washers or thread-locker. A secure installation prevents the jack from twisting or snapping under lateral stress.

Finally, place a heavy-duty leveling pad or a thick block of wood under the jack foot to prevent it from sinking into soft ground. A jack sitting directly on dirt or grass will inevitably sink as the ground becomes saturated with moisture. A wider base provides a more stable foundation and prevents the jack from losing contact with the frame.

Jack Maintenance: Preventing Rust and Seizing

A jack left exposed to the elements will eventually seize, especially if you live in a coastal or humid environment. To keep your system operational, clean the threads of the jack at least twice a year and apply a generous coating of marine-grade grease. This keeps the lead screw moving smoothly and prevents the oxidation that leads to thread binding.

If you are stationary for long periods, consider adding a protective boot or a homemade cover over the jack mechanism to shield it from road salt, water, and debris. While scissor jacks are durable, they are not immune to the corrosive power of moisture. A small amount of preventative maintenance during your seasonal changeover saves hours of frustration when it comes time to move.

If you ever notice a jack becoming difficult to crank, stop immediately. Attempting to force a seized jack can strip the internal gears or bend the arms beyond repair. Clean the mechanism, re-lubricate, and test it under a no-load condition before placing it back into service.
